Verdict
A couple of these stand out though it was heavy going when Gerolamo Cardano ended a long losing with a victory over track and trip at the end of last year so ACCIDENTAL LEGEND makes more appeal. The latter bids for a hat-trick having improved for the step up to today’s trip and looks worth sticking with. Click And Collect placed over a shorter distance at Newcastle when last in action at this time last year while Yellow Jacket makes his handicap debut.
